Parking Slab Repair in West Des Moines, IA
Parking slab repair services address issues related to the concrete surface that forms the foundation of driveways, parking areas, and other paved surfaces on residential properties. These repairs typically involve fixing cracks, potholes, uneven sections, and surface deterioration caused by weather conditions, ground movement, or regular wear and tear. Property owners often request this service to improve safety, enhance curb appeal, and prevent further damage that could lead to more extensive and costly repairs in the future.
Before requesting parking slab repair, homeowners should consider the extent of the damage and whether the underlying soil or base needs attention. It’s helpful to understand the age of the slab, the severity of cracks or surface issues, and any signs of shifting or sinking. Proper assessment can ensure that repairs address both surface problems and any foundational concerns, leading to a more durable and long-lasting result.

Common Parking Slab Repair Jobs
Parking slab repair addresses cracks, potholes, and surface deterioration to restore safety and appearance.
Concrete resurfacing involves smoothing and sealing the surface to extend the lifespan of the slab.
Crack sealing prevents water infiltration that can cause further damage and structural issues.
Pothole patching quickly fills and levels damaged areas to improve safety and usability.
Surface leveling corrects uneven slabs to prevent tripping hazards and facilitate vehicle movement.
Full slab replacement is recommended when repairs are no longer effective for severely damaged surfaces.
Parking Slab Repair Questions
What causes cracks in parking slabs? Cracks often result from soil movement, temperature changes, or repeated stress on the slab surface.
When should a parking slab be repaired? Repairs are recommended when visible cracks, uneven surfaces, or damage affect safety or drainage.
What types of repair options are available? Options include crack filling, slab leveling, and complete replacement, depending on the extent of damage.
How can property owners prevent future damage? Proper drainage, soil stabilization, and timely repairs help maintain the integrity of parking slabs.
